Lines 100-125: state a theme of the story and cite textual evidence that supports your response, FROM THE SHORT STORY MY LIFE AS

A BAT BY: MARGARET ATWOOD

The Theme of My Life As A Bat is that bats are treated horribly by humans.

<span>In lines 21-29 Atwood states "I have recurring nightmares. In one of them I am clinging to the ceiling of a summer cottage, while a red-faced man in white shorts and a white V-neck T-shirt jumps up and down hitting me with a tennis racket. </span>
These lines are a reference to how humans treat bats. The man is trying to get rid of her because he feels as if he is in danger. Atwood uses the line "hitting me with a racket" to show how she was treated. He does not care for her well being, he just wants to get rid of her.
<span>Bats are seen as objects more than the wonderful and interesting creatures they are. We as humans should try and inform others more on how bats are not as dangerous as they seem.</span>

According to Thoreau in "Civil Disobedience", what are the three types of men?
Hitman42 [59]
<span>According to Thoreau in "Civil Disobedience", there are three types of men which are; 
The first group is soldiers or war type men, "the militia, jailers, constables,etc." These men do not think. They are told by the state exactly what to do.
The second group is made up of lawyers and legislators and ministers who use their minds but still guided by the state.
The third group is comprised of "heroes, patriots, and martyrs." These are people who think for themselves and are not subservient to the state</span>
